django中一个变量与某个值进行比较, 显示不同按钮
Django中{% ifequal A B %} 用来比较A和B两个值是否相等,{% ifnotequal A B %}` 用来比较A和B两个值是否不相等。。
如:
{% ifequal A B %}
No welcome!
1.判断等于某个字符时, 显示该按钮
- {% if ifequal role.remark 'abc' %}
- {% endifequal%}
2.判断不等于某个字符, 则显示该按钮
- {% if ifnotequal role.remark 'abc' %}
- {% endifnotequal%}
3.判断如果包含某个字符串, 则显示该按钮
- {% if 'abc' in role.remark %}
- {% endif%}
4.判断如果不包含某个字符串, 则显示该按钮
- {% if 'abc' not in role.remark %}
- {% endif%}
注意:
endif需与前面保持一致